Alabama's heat and occasional severe weather make covered decks a smart choice for year-round comfort. We design and build overhead structures—pergolas, pavilions, and solid covers—that shield you from sun and rain while maintaining sightlines and airflow.
Whether you want partial shade or a fully enclosed structure, we engineer covered decks built to code and designed to last decades in Shelby County's climate.

Composite decking, pressure-treated lumber, and tropical hardwoods are all solid choices. Composite resists Alabama's humidity and requires less maintenance. Pressure-treated lumber is budget-friendly and proven. Hardwoods offer beauty and durability. We help you choose based on your priorities, style, and budget.
